Calories: 169 per servingCategory: Side Dish1. In a small bowl combine soy sauce, brown sugar, garlic, ginger and black pepper. Set aside.
2. Remove Yaki Soba from packages and discard included flavoring packets. Rinse noodles well, drain, and set aside.
3. Heat oil in a large wok or skillet. Add celery and onion and saute for about 1-2 minutes or until onions start to become soft and transparent. Add cabbage and saute an additional minute.
4. Add Yaki Soba noodles and soy sauce mixture with the vegetables and stir-fry over medium-high heat for an additional 2-3 minutes or until noodles are heated through.

Total Time: 30 minsCategory: DinnerCalories: 366 per serving1. Cook the pasta according to package directions until al dente. Set aside.
2. Season the chicken with salt and pepper. Add half the oil to a wok or skillet over high heat. Add the chicken and cook until no longer pink. Set aside.
3. Add remaining oil along with the carrots and celery. Cook for 3-4 minutes. Add the remaining vegetables and 1-2 tablespoons of water if burning. Cook for 3-4 minutes until tender.
4. Add the chicken, spaghetti, oyster sauce, soy sauce, and chicken broth. Cook for 1 minute.
